본문 바로가기
컴퓨터/프로그래밍

남이 개발한 프로그램 코드를 받을 때

by Begi 2020. 4. 11.
반응형

남이 개발하고 있는 프로그램 코드를 받아 이어서 개발하는 것은 조금 어려운 일이다. 처음부터 자신이 개발하지 않았기 때문에 프로그램을 분석하는데 시간이 꽤 걸린다.

 

그래서, 어떤 사람들은 다른 사람이 개발하던 프로그램을 사용하지 않고 처음부터 다시 개발하기도 한다. 처음부터 다시 개발하는 경우를 몇 번 보았다. 이럴 경우 시간이 부족하여 매우 고생하게 된다.

 

남의 코드를 이어 받지 못하는 이유는 이전 개발자가 프로그램을 너무 이상하게 코딩한 경우도 있지만 대부분은 받는 개발자가 코드 분석 능력이 부족한 경우가 많다. 이전 개발자가 아주 실력이 없는 경우가 아니라면 프로그램 구조가 아주 나쁘지는 않고 이러한 구조를 분석하고 이해해야 한다.

 

코드 분석 능력이 있으면 프로그램을 이어 받더라도 크게 힘들이지 않고 개발을 이어갈 수 있고 시간과 비용을 크게 절약할 수 있다.

 

프로그램을 이어 받는 것을 기분 나쁘게 생각하는 심리적인 이유도 있는데, 남이 작성한 코드를 보면 배울 점들이 있고 소스를 분석하다 보면 나름 재미있다.

 

반응형

댓글